谷歌云服务器怎么样,谷歌云服务器能做什么操作
- 综合资讯
- 2024-09-30 18:08:59
- 3
***:此内容主要围绕谷歌云服务器展开。一是询问谷歌云服务器的性能状况,包括其在稳定性、速度、安全性等方面的表现。二是关注谷歌云服务器能够进行的操作,如是否适合用于搭建...
***:本文围绕谷歌云服务器展开,主要探讨两个方面,一是谷歌云服务器自身的状况,二是其能进行的操作。旨在让读者了解谷歌云服务器的相关特性,包括性能、稳定性等方面的情况,以及在数据存储、计算处理、搭建网络服务、运行各类应用程序等操作方面的能力,以帮助读者对谷歌云服务器有一个初步的认识与评估。
《探索谷歌云服务器的多功能操作与卓越性能》
谷歌云服务器是一种强大的云计算服务,为用户提供了众多的操作可能性,在各个领域发挥着重要的作用。
一、开发与测试环境搭建
1、软件开发
- 对于软件开发团队来说,谷歌云服务器提供了一个便捷的开发环境,开发人员可以快速创建虚拟机实例,选择适合的操作系统,如Linux(Ubuntu、CentOS等)或者Windows Server,在这个环境中,他们可以安装所需的开发工具,如编程语言解释器(Python、Java等)、代码编辑器(Visual Studio Code的服务器版本等)和版本控制系统(Git)。
- 以一个Web开发项目为例,开发人员可以在谷歌云服务器上搭建Web服务器(如Apache或Nginx),配置数据库(MySQL或PostgreSQL),然后开始编写和测试Web应用程序代码,这种云端开发环境便于团队成员之间的协作,因为大家可以通过网络远程访问同一个开发环境,提高了开发效率。
2、测试自动化
- 在软件测试方面,谷歌云服务器能够模拟各种不同的运行环境,测试人员可以创建多个不同配置的虚拟机实例,用于进行兼容性测试,测试一款移动应用在不同版本的Android系统上的运行情况,或者测试一个网站在不同浏览器和操作系统组合下的兼容性。
- 通过谷歌云服务器还可以轻松实现自动化测试框架的搭建,利用工具如Selenium和Appium,可以编写脚本在云服务器上自动执行测试用例,大大缩短了测试周期,并且能够及时发现软件中的缺陷。
二、数据存储与管理
1、大规模数据存储
- 谷歌云服务器提供了可靠的存储解决方案,其对象存储服务(Google Cloud Storage)适合存储各种类型的文件,如图片、视频、文档等,对于企业来说,如果有大量的用户上传文件需要存储,例如一个社交媒体平台,谷歌云存储可以轻松应对海量数据的存储需求。
- 它还支持数据的冗余存储,确保数据的安全性和可用性,用户可以根据自己的需求选择不同的存储类别,如标准存储、近线存储和冷线存储,以平衡成本和数据访问频率的关系。
2、数据库管理
- 谷歌云提供了多种数据库服务,包括关系型数据库(如Cloud SQL,支持MySQL、PostgreSQL等)和非关系型数据库(如Cloud Firestore,适用于移动和Web应用的NoSQL数据库)。
- 对于一个电商企业,使用Cloud SQL可以高效地管理产品信息、用户订单等数据,关系型数据库的结构化查询语言(SQL)便于进行复杂的数据查询和事务处理,而对于一些需要快速扩展和灵活数据模型的应用,如实时聊天应用,Cloud Firestore的无模式数据结构可以更好地满足需求,允许快速插入和查询大量的实时数据。
三、企业级应用部署与运行
1、企业资源规划(ERP)系统
- 许多企业依赖ERP系统来管理企业内部的资源,如财务、人力资源、供应链等,谷歌云服务器可以为ERP系统提供强大的运行环境,企业可以将ERP软件部署在云服务器上,通过网络让企业内部的各个部门访问。
- 这样做的好处是,企业无需在本地构建昂贵的硬件基础设施,并且可以根据企业的发展灵活调整云服务器的资源配置,当企业业务扩张,需要更多的计算资源来处理增加的订单和财务数据时,可以轻松地在谷歌云平台上升级服务器配置。
2、客户关系管理(CRM)系统
- 对于CRM系统而言,谷歌云服务器能够确保系统的高可用性和可扩展性,销售团队可以通过基于云的CRM系统实时更新客户信息、跟踪销售机会等。
- 谷歌云的安全机制,如身份验证和访问控制,有助于保护企业客户数据的安全,其全球的数据中心分布可以让企业在不同地区的分支机构都能快速、稳定地访问CRM系统,提高了企业的运营效率。
四、大数据与人工智能应用
1、大数据分析
- 谷歌云服务器为大数据分析提供了丰富的工具和计算资源,通过谷歌的BigQuery服务,企业可以处理海量的结构化和半结构化数据,一家零售企业可以分析多年的销售数据,包括商品销售数量、顾客购买时间、地域分布等信息。
- 在云服务器上,可以利用开源的大数据框架如Hadoop和Spark,结合机器学习算法进行数据挖掘,通过分析这些数据,企业可以发现销售趋势、顾客偏好等有价值的信息,从而制定更精准的营销策略。
2、人工智能模型训练与部署
- 在人工智能领域,谷歌云服务器是训练和部署模型的理想选择,对于深度学习模型,如卷积神经网络(CNN)用于图像识别或循环神经网络(RNN)用于自然语言处理,训练过程需要大量的计算资源。
- 谷歌云的高性能计算实例(如NVIDIA GPU - 加速的实例)能够加速模型的训练过程,一旦模型训练完成,还可以将其部署在云服务器上,通过API接口提供给其他应用或用户使用,一个智能客服机器人的自然语言处理模型可以部署在谷歌云服务器上,实时响应用户的咨询。
五、网络服务与安全保障
1、虚拟专用网络(VPN)和网络安全
- 企业可以利用谷歌云服务器构建自己的虚拟专用网络,这有助于保护企业内部网络的安全,特别是对于远程办公的员工,通过VPN连接到企业内部资源,如文件服务器和内部应用程序,员工可以在安全的网络环境下工作。
- 谷歌云本身提供了强大的网络安全功能,如防火墙、入侵检测和预防系统等,这些功能可以保护云服务器免受外部网络攻击,确保服务器上运行的应用和数据的安全。
2、内容分发网络(CDN)
- 谷歌云的CDN服务(Google Cloud CDN)可以加速内容的分发,对于网站所有者来说,如果他们的网站有大量的静态内容(如图片、CSS和JavaScript文件),通过将这些内容分发到谷歌云CDN的全球节点,可以大大提高用户访问网站的速度。
- 一个全球性的新闻网站,其图片和文章内容可以通过CDN快速地传递给世界各地的读者,提高了用户体验,同时也减轻了源服务器的负载。
谷歌云服务器在开发、测试、数据管理、企业应用、大数据与人工智能以及网络安全等多个方面都提供了丰富的操作功能和卓越的性能,为企业和开发者提供了一个强大而灵活的云计算平台。
本文链接:https://www.zhitaoyun.cn/97588.html
发表评论